摘要
讨论了利用几何光学射线法的接收公式(即间接射线法)计算大电尺寸天线罩的功率传输系数、瞄准误差以及瞄准误差斜率的基本理论和分析步骤,并与物理光学法和几何光学射线法的发射公式(即直接射线法)进行了比较,从而说明利用间接射线法计算天线罩的功率传输系数、瞄准误差和瞄准误差斜率既能满足工程上的精度要求,又减少了工作量。
This paper discusses the basic theory and analytical steps of using indirect ray method to calculate power transmission coefficient, boresight error and boresight error slope of large dimension radome. Furthermore, indirect ray method is compared with direct ray method of geometrical optics and physical optics, which proves that indirect ray method not only satisfies the required engineering precision, but reduces the complexity of calculation as well.
